N-Phenyl-p-phenylenediamine

(101-54-2)
Dye intermediate, pharmaceuticals, photographic chemicals. 4-Aminodiphenylamine is used as an oxidation dye color in hair dyes. It is also promoted as an efficient reagent for oxidase enzymes, including glucose, lactate, xanthine, and lysine oxidases.

Direct Red 23

(3441-14-3)
It is mainly used for dyeing and printing of fiber fabrics such as cotton, viscose, and hemp. It can also be used for dyeing silk and wool. It can also be used for dyeing paper and leather, and for the manufacture of lake pigments. In addition to dyeing scarlet and crimson (yellow light red) color alone, it is also used to match colors with yellow, orange, red, brown and other dyes. Hair dyeing product is a substance or formulation used to color or alter the natural color of hair. According to the method of hair dyeing, products can be divided into permanent hair dye and temporary hair dye. Permanent hair dye products typically contain oxidizing agents and dye. According to the composition of hair dye products, they can be classified into natural hair dyes and chemical hair dyes. Hair dyeing is a cosmetic method to change hair color, typically achieved by applying hair dye to transition from one color to another. The principle of hair dyeing involves chemical substances penetrating the hair's cuticle layer and reacting with its natural pigments to alter its color.

Hair dyeing relies on chemical reactions. Different types of hair dyes operate on distinct principles. For permanent hair dye, for instance, the dye and oxidizing agent (usually hydrogen peroxide) are initially mixed. This activates the dye precursors in the dye, allowing them to penetrate the hair fiber. These dye precursors infiltrate the hair's cuticle layer and reach the cortex. Within the cortex, they undergo an oxidation reaction with the oxidizing agent, forming large pigment molecules. These molecules combine with the hair's natural melanin, creating new pigment complexes that alter the hair color.

Frequently Asked Questions

What is hair dyeing and how does it work?

Hair dyeing is the process of changing the natural color of hair using chemical or natural formulations. Most permanent hair dyes contain ingredients like ammonia, hydrogen peroxide, and color precursors that penetrate the hair shaft to alter melanin pigment. Semi-permanent and temporary dyes coat the hair surface without deep penetration. Understanding how hair dye works helps users choose the right type based on desired longevity, coverage, and hair health considerations.

What are the different types of hair dye available?

There are four main types of hair dye:1. Permanent hair dye: Offers long-lasting color change and full gray coverage by chemically altering hair structure.2. Demi-permanent dye: Lasts 4–6 weeks, deposits color without lifting natural pigment, and causes less damage.3. Semi-permanent dye: Washes out after 4–12 shampoos and contains no ammonia.4. Temporary dye: Includes sprays, rinses, or chalks that last until the next wash. Choosing the right type depends on your goals for coverage, duration, and hair condition.

Is hair dyeing safe for all hair types?

Hair dyeing can be safe for most hair types when used correctly, but sensitivity varies. Coarse or curly hair may absorb dye differently than fine or straight hair, affecting results and potential damage. Those with previously colored, bleached, or damaged hair should opt for gentler formulas like ammonia-free or demi-permanent dyes. Always perform a patch test 48 hours before application to check for allergic reactions, and follow manufacturer instructions to minimize scalp irritation or breakage.

How can I minimize damage when dyeing my hair?

To reduce hair damage during dyeing:1. Use high-quality, sulfate-free dyes with conditioning agents.2. Avoid overlapping dye on previously colored sections.3. Limit frequency of re-dyeing—touch up roots only when needed.4. Deep condition regularly and use heat protectants.5. Consider professional application for complex processes like bleaching or highlighting. Proper aftercare, including color-safe shampoos and UV protection, also preserves hair integrity and color vibrancy.
